Nearby Towns

Santo Domingo de Heredia

This is a small town situated halfway between Heredia and San Jose. Many of the houses and building have been restored to their former glory. The locals are pretty friendly as well.

San Joaquin

This small town is located just 3 miles from Heredia. It is a great place to visit and have a very nice feel to it. Just to the north of the town lie extensive coffee plantations, and slightly further to the north rises the Barva volcano. This town tends to be fairly upscale and is home to some nice nightlife options. If you are in the area stop by the butterfly farm. The farm has an extensive collection of native butterflies. Stroll through their gardens and you can see numerous butterflies in the varies stages of their life cycle.

Monte de la Cruz Reserve

Costa Rica is famous for its extensive national park system. What is less well known is the fact that there are numerous private reserves as well. Just a short distance north of San Rafael is the private reserve of Monte de la Cruz. There is an extensive network of trails throughout the park. Hike the trails and you have the opportunity to see fantastic plant and animal life. Some trails lead to Braulio Carillo National Park, and other offer excellent views of the surrounding valley.

Bosque Del Rio de la Hoja

Another private reserve area is the Bosque del Rio de la Hoja. This forest area is popular as a hiking destination. Additionally there are numerous recreational facilities including soccer fields, a pool, a go cart track, plus much more! Very popular with the locals on the weekends. Additionally there is a nice typical Costa Rican restaurant nearby. Camping is available.

San Rafael

This is a quaint little town less than 3 miles to the north of the town of Heredia. Many of the people that work in Heredia live in this town. Its most distinctive landmark is a small gothic style church which is unusual.

Santa Barbara de Heredia

Another town close to Heredia is Santa Barbara de Heredia. Located around the corner from San Joacquin, the town is home to a variety of adobe style homes.
